ecuflash load rescale map..correct or not?

i just finished rescaling my load on my ecuflash ....at first they were stock from 0 to 260..now there from 0 to 300,i just wana post my maps up and let you guys see if there correct and i should flash it in my car.

i have posted both maps,plz take a look and see if i made any mistakes and need to change anything.

As you scan across the load columns from left to right, especially for your low oct ign map, there should be no more than 5* difference for a change of 20 load. For example you change from 26* to 16* at 3500 rpm when moving from 80 to 100 load. This is right in the spool transition to boost and is likely to give you some knock (=bad for your engine). Try smoothing the transition more to something like this.
